PRAYER: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of Constitution of India praying for the issuance of the Writ of Mandamus, to consider the petitioner's representations dated 13.02.2023 and forbearing the respondents 1 to 3 or their men, agents from interfering with the peaceful conduct of business i.e. cross massage in the name and style of "Dolphine Ayurvedic Body Massage Centre," at No.1103/98B, Ground Floor, Koothapadi Village, Hokenakal, Pennagaram Taluk, Dharmapuri District.

For Petitioner : Mr.D.Jagadeesan For Respondents : Mr.S.Santhosh Government Advocate (Crl. Side)

ORDER

This Writ Petition has been filed for the issuance of Writ of Mandamus, to consider the petitioner's representation dated 13.02.2023 and forbearing the respondents 1 to 3 or their men, agents from interfering with the peaceful conduct of business i.e. cross massage in the name and style of "Dolphine Ayurvedic Body Massage Centre," at No.1103/98B, Ground Floor, Koothapadi Village, Hokenakal, Pennagaram Taluk, Dharmapuri District.

2. When the matter is taken up, the learned Government Advocate (Crl. Side) submitted that the petitioner's representation dated 13.02.2023 is not received by the respondents. If a fresh representation is given by the petitioner,

appropriate orders will be passed.

3. Considering the submission of the learned Government Advocate (Crl. Side), this Court directs the petitioner to submit a fresh representation. On such submission of a fresh representation, the respondents are directed to consider and pass appropriate orders, in the manner know to law, within a period of four weeks from the date of receipt of fresh representation.

4. With the above directions, this Writ petition is disposed of. Consequently, connected Miscellaneous petition is closed. No costs. 26.04.2023 mn Index:Yes/No Speaking Order: Yes/No
